Multiple Unsafe Priorities at Driveways

North Hyde Lane near Raleigh Road. Image (1) Illustrates multiple unsafe and inappropriate priorities creating conflicts between bike riders and motorists. Images (2) & (3) illustrate examples where priority is correctly given to "Vulnerable road users" (see Highway code cited below).
Please can these hazardous markings be rectified to enhance safety and to grant appropriate priority. We must encourage "Active Travel" in the interests of health and the environment.
Please also refer to the following:- (a) “The Highway Code - Road users requiring extra care (204 – 225)” https://www.gov.uk/ guidance/ the-highway-code/ road-users-requiring-extra-care-204-to-225
(b) “… drivers entering or leaving a driveway must give way to cycleway users”. See section 2 https://www.nzta.govt.nz/ assets/ Walking-Cycling-and-Public-Transport/ docs/ cycling-network-guidance/ tech-notes/ TN002-separated-cycleways-guidance-note.pdf
(c) “Where a footway or a cycleway crosses a driveway, both should continue across it without interruption, with a smooth, level, continuous surface.” https://www.cycling-embassy.org.uk/ dictionary/ driveway
(d) “Reducing driveway conflict on cycleways” https://saferroadsconference.com/ wp-content/ uploads/ 2017/ 06/ 5A-Reducing-driveway-conflict-on-cycleways.pdf
(e) “Treatment options to improve safety of pedestrians, bicycle riders and other path users at driveways” Figure 3.3(b) – Driveway with good speed control provided by horizontal and vertical geometry” https://www.tmr.qld.gov.au/ _/ media/ busind/ techstdpubs/ cycling/ guideline-path-users-and-driveways.pdf?sc_lang=en&hash=9EB7057A58CAEBF5397C168635EF04D2

In case you'd prefer to believe this, see Rule 206 in the Highway Code - "needing to cross a pavement, cycle lane or cycle track; for example, to reach or leave a driveway or private access. Give way to pedestrians on the pavement and cyclists using a cycle lane or cycle track"
